报警管理在化工厂的应用及优化

摘要 报警超载是制造工厂中普遍存在的一个问题。由于以往相互独立的系统逐步集成,操作人员减少,每个操作人员监控的区域范围相应随之扩大,需要处理的报警也随之增多。由于缺乏严格的报警合理化措施,报警泛滥正逐渐成为一项严峻问题,工厂面临着不断增长的安全与环境事故风险。横河系统引进的EXPLOG可以对报警进行分析,但是缺乏可利用工具直接去降低报警泛滥,通过自定义报警分级以及增加开停工自动报警屏蔽和多工况下自动切换报警值等手段,从根本上降低异常工况下的报警数量,从而达到深度优化报警,减少无效报警的目的。 Alarm overload is a common problem in manufacturing plants.Due to the gradual integration of independent systems in the past,the number of operators is reduced,the area monitored by each operator is correspondingly expanded,and the number of alarms that need to be processed also increases.In the absence of strict alarm rationalization measures,alarm flooding is becoming a serious problem,and factories face a growing risk of safety and environmental incidents.The EXPLOG introduced by Yokogawa can analyze the alarms,but there is a lack of tools to directly reduce the alarm flooding.By customizing the alarm classification and increasing the automatic alarm masking of start-up and shutdown and automatic switching of alarm values under multiple working conditions,fundamentally reduce the number of alarms under abnormal working conditions,so as to achieve the purpose of deeply optimizing alarms and reducing invalid alarms.
